Originally published in 1938, this book presents the content of a report made to the Pilgrim Trust on the subject of unemployment and the needs of the unemployed. It was designed to provide the Pilgrim Trustees with guidance on the allocation of funding in relation to the social problems associated with unemployment. Numerous investigators contributed to the report, which was overseen by a committee led by William Temple, Archbishop of York at the time of publication. Detailed textual notes and an appendices section are also included. This book will be of value to anyone with an interest in British history, social history and unemployment.
